A new bishop has been appointed to the Anglican diocese which includes Guernsey and Jersey. The Reverend Canon Paul Butler will be the next Suffragan Bishop of Southampton in the Diocese of Winchester.
His duties will include regular visits to the island to officiate at services and church events.
He succeeds The Right Reverend Jonathan Gledhill, who became the Bishop of Lichfield last November.
Canon Butler is currently team Rector of Walthamstow, Area Dean of Waltham Forest in the Diocese of Chelmsford and a non-residentiary canon of St Paul's Cathedral in Rwanda.
Canon Butler will work alongside the Bishop of Winchester, the Right Reverend Michael Scott-Joynt and the Bishop of Basingstoke, the Right Reverend Trevor Wilmott.
He will be consecrated on 24 June at Southwark Cathedral by the Archbishop of Canterbury and a service of welcome will be held for him at Winchester Cathedral on 4 July.
